interpretations of the Tarot by Barbara Walker is rooted in Tantric philosophy. The illustrations show the religious ideas of India, the Middle East, Europe and Egypt. Some letters also illustrate beliefs ancient pagan.
The mysteries are recognizable by sight and that evoke the Waite Tarot decks and Marseille in symbolism, although there are some exceptions and some subtle changes.
Barbara Walker to the Major Arcana are symbols of initiation into the mysteries of pre-Christian religions, which ruled the goddess and was accepted reincarnation. To that end, she takes the interpretations based on the patriarchal society and restore the original matriarch.

The court cards are quite marked differences compared to other traditional roofing and replaces Walker by: kings, queens, princes and princesses, each carrying the name and the specific image of a god or a goddess from mythology, significant and representative of the characteristics of that card.
